Bioabsorbable Polymer Companies in the UK

Bioabsorbable polymer companies develop materials designed to degrade safely within the body after performing a temporary medical function. These polymers are used across drug delivery, tissue repair, surgical devices and regenerative medicine.

This category includes companies working on:

  • Biodegradable and resorbable medical polymers
  • Drug delivery systems and controlled-release materials
  • Sutures, implants and temporary medical devices
  • Tissue engineering scaffolds
  • Polymer formulation, processing and manufacturing
